If you plan to use your scooter for outdoor or indoor activities, it is recommended to choose the model suited to those purposes. For instance, if be using your scooter in shopping malls or other places that are crowded you'll need a compact scooter that can navigate tight spaces.
On the other hand, if you'll be traveling longer distances on your scooter, then you'll need an extra large model that can take on rough terrain and longer distances with a single charge. These scooters, which are also referred to as high-performance or 4WD scooters, are generally more expensive than the standard models.
Another thing to take into consideration when selecting a mobility scooter is the capacity to weigh. This is important for older users, who may have a heavier body weight. This information is available on the manufacturer's website or Where To Buy Mobility Scooter by contacting the dealer.
You'll want to make sure that the scooter can accommodate any gear or clothing you may need while on the go. If you need to carry bulky items or large objects, choose an automobile with a basket in the rear or front that can be locked.
Finally, you'll need to be aware of whether your scooter needs to be insured. While it's not necessary but it's an excellent idea in the event of damage or theft. Your homeowners or renters policy might be able to cover a scooter.
Scooter Features
When selecting a scooter, think about the maximum speed, ground clearance and turning radius. Also, think about the battery's life. Some scooters include extras like adjustable armrests seats, Where to Buy Mobility scooter LED lights and suspension. When determining your budget, ensure that you include the cost of these extra features.
Another thing to keep in mind is whether you'll be using a scooter for medical purposes. If this is the case, you'll need get a doctor's prescription and proof of medical necessity before your insurance company will cover the cost. If not, you'll have to pay the cost out of pocket.
